12-2016 Sawed off bottom o' nose cone and epoxied in a 1/4" plywood cap with a screw eye. Begad! Blimey! Should give me more room for packin' t' parachute. Well, blow me down! Blimey! Supposed t' deploy better too, shiver me timbers, accordin' t' forum members with frequent lawn-darts.

My first build as a "BAR." I didn't have t' internet when last buildin' rockets, which probably made things a lot easier. Avast! This rocket has filled body tube seams and papered fins - two things I never would have thought o' as a child. Well, blow me down! Also I used a kevlar shock cord mounted t' t' engine mount. Paint and decal design be done by committee o' me, me two sons and wife.
